Boxing just sold 4.4million PPV's at $100 a piece, not to mention the broadcast rights and PPV's from other countries, sponsers, live gate etc.
Boxing is fine. The fight was ****. Everyone will forget about it soon, except for the advertising and TV network execs. They wont forget a payday like that in a hurry.
Boxing might well be the worst run sport in the world, but it still manages to make a lot of people a lot of money.
